Abiodun Ogunnubi is an Associate in the Firm’s Dispute Resolution Department. She has garnered over 9 years professional experience as a litigation and Alternative Dispute Resolution expert. Prior to joining the firm, she was a key member of the Dispute Resolution team of a reputable law firm in Lagos, Nigeria specialized in litigation and arbitration where she acquired experience advising clients on various aspects of Nigerian law. She has appeared before trial and appellate courts in commercial and general civil disputes covering a broad range of causes including contractual, banking, defamation, real estate disputes, etc. She has a special interest in general commercial transactions and corporate governance, international commercial law, dispute avoidance and resolution through alternative dispute resolution mechanisms, etc.

She has advised individual and corporate clients in diverse industries, including, but not limited to representing a leading recording artist in an arbitral proceedings over a multi-million Naira entertainment dispute between the artist and his producer over breach of the Record Contract, a core member of the team that advised and represented the victims of gas pipeline explosion in Nigeria on applicable remedies, advised a confidential client on the applicability of legislative amendments to extant statutes on notarial services in Nigeria, a core member of a team led by a Senior Advocate of Nigeria that successfully that successfully recovered a multi-billion Naira loan facility on behalf of a consortium of commercial banks in Nigeria.
